Walt Disney's Comics and Stories v1 #272, 1963 - When Donald Duck opens a barber shop, he discovers a talent for cutting hair. Nearby, a circus gorilla named Horrendo runs amok in the city. Carl Barks flexes his creativity in this tale, devising different methods and hair designs for a variety of customers. The scenes are funny as they are unconventional, a skill that the artist's peers could rarely match. This story was later reprinted in Walt Disney Comics Digest #39. Other characters featured in this issue include Gyro Gearloose, Ludwig Von Drake, Mickey Mouse and the Big Bad Wolf. Other artists in this silver age comic include Paul Murry.
